Types of UPVC Door Handles

It is essential to select the right replacement window handle upvc handle for your home when your handles are in need of replacement. Locksmiths can supply and install high-security uPVC door handles that have additional security features.

The most important measurements to take are the measurement A (also called PZ) and the length of the backplate. Check these measurements to ensure your new uPVC handle will fit.

Lever/Pad

Lever pad handles are a kind of upvc door handle that have levers on both sides to operate the multipoint lock. They are available in a variety of variations and finishes and are suitable for a variety of materials like UPVC, Aluminium & Timber doors. They are sold in pairs for the outer and inner door, with screws and spindles included. They are available in hand- and non-handled versions to meet the needs of different users.

These are often used for new constructions and are installed to replace existing upvc doors. They are typically operated by lifting the levers, which throw out all of the multipoint locks, and turning the key to close / unlock. They provide additional security in comparison to lever handles for doors as the locking operation is only accessible by entering the door with keys in the event that the door is locked.

They're not as secure as a cylinder lock, but they are cost-effective ways to increase the security of your home. The only drawback is that they don't have the same level of security like a cylinder bolt and therefore don't stop external access in the event that the door has been left open.

The majority of the lever pad upvc door handles we stock are made by the top manufacturers in the industry and will be manufactured with good quality components. In general, they are supplied with a manufacturer's warranty.

They are typically designed to work with the 92mm lock, or a replacement model called the Paddock Lock. They will feature a cylinder with 82mm diameter on the inside and 62mm outside. They also come with two spindle followers. Some come with a backplate in place, while others are movable to accommodate different fixing centers.

Lever/Moveable Pad

This is a well-known handle style for front doors that has the benefit of preventing the door from being opened from the outside without keys if the lock isn't deadlocked. This is achieved by using an external handle that is shaped like a pad that locks into the gap between the handle and lock case.

This type of handle is designed for uPVC doors with multipoint locks that operate with a split spindle operation. This kind of operation requires that the lever handle and the external pad handle are both fitted to the same lock case. This can be a simple replacement for the current uPVC handle, however it may also require a lock case change or a new set of handles to handle furniture.

These aluminium lever/movable pads door handles are suitable to be used on uPVC and come with a maintenance-free slide bearing. They also include fixing lugs, spring cassettes, and an unstick slide bearing. These handles feature an euro-profile cut out and can be mounted on various uPVC or wood doors.

The lever moveable pad is available in many finishes to suit a wide variety of multipoint locks. They are designed to work with split spindle multipoint locks with a 92mm cylinder and require a separate split spindle set as supplied by the lock manufacturer.
